Product Details

The Hikvision DS-KD-ACW3/S is a surface-mount housing designed for the Hikvision DS-KD-xx modular intercom system. It allows for the installation of three intercom modules, offering a secure and durable setup without the need for in-wall mounting. This version features a stainless steel cover combined with an aluminum frame, ensuring enhanced durability and corrosion resistance. The package includes three module frames, three front panels, a button cover, and installation accessories for easy mounting.

Key Features:

  • Surface-Mount Design – Ideal for installations where flush-mounting is not possible.
  • Three-Module Capacity – Designed to accommodate three intercom modules.
  • Durable ConstructionStainless steel cover for corrosion resistance and aluminum frame for structural strength.
  • Complete Installation Kit – Includes three module frames, three front panels, a button cover, and other mounting accessories.

Dimensions:

  • Cover: 320.8 × 107 × 4 mm
  • Frame: 320.8 × 107 × 32.7 mm

Compatibility:

Designed for use with Hikvision DS-KD-xx modular intercom systems.
